H.E. Sheikh Nahayan Mabarak Al Nahayan, Minister of Tolerance & Coexistence Becomes a Patron of The Zay Initiative
Last Update: Monday, October 5, 2020 : 09:24 (+4GMT)
UAE’s Minister of Tolerance & Coexistence will help sustain the legacy
United Arab Emirates, October 05, 2020: The Zay Initiative is delighted to announce that H.E. Sheikh Nahayan Mabarak Al Nahayan, Minister of Tolerance & Coexistence, is now patron of the organization. As a patron he will act as a figurehead of the organization in the UAE, supporting with speeches and events.
The Zay Initiative a non-profit, UK registered initiative is dedicated to the preservation of cultural heritage through the collection, documentation and digital archiving of Arab historical attire and their stories. Its’ goal is to empower and sustain global cross-cultural dialogue to inspire creative minds.
“I am very happy to offer my support to an organization that builds up public awareness and appreciation of this unique heritage, and reaches out to like-minded individuals and institutions nationally, regionally and globally,” said H.E. Sheikh Nahayan Mabarak Al Nahayan.
LAUNCHES FOR THE ZAY
This summer, The Zay Initiative launched five webinar series, during which The Zay’s founder, Dr. Reem el Mutwalli, and a cultural expert discuss relevant topics on a bi-weekly basis. To date they have covered jewellery, faith and the hijab, dress and diplomacy and more, using the webinars to explore the various links to culture and fashion. They will run until April 2021.
The Zay’s “Collection” is now live; a unique regional digital archive of Arabic dress, free of charge for everyone to explore. Easy to navigate, you can search the archive by decade, by country, by garment and more. The documented detail, the digital glossary and scale of the collection itself is painstakingly impressive, and it is an invaluable source for research, reference or academic requirements; an excellent and unique asset to fashion designers, historical or design studies and cultural relations. There will be 1350 itemized articles in the Collection by the end of this year.
